Melatonin Helps Promote Normal Sleep
Melatonin is mostly known for it’s powerful effect on getting sleep. In fact, your body produces the melatonin for sleep; when it becomes dark your body starts producing more melatonin which makes you sleepy, when it gets light the production lowers and you are awake. Melatonin for Jet lag and working rotating shifts
Jet lag and work shifts are very disconcerting. They hamper your ability to think clearly. Jet lag disrupts your body clock especially when you have been to a different time zone and therefore it may take you some time before your body clock goes back to normal. Mix jet lag with fatigue and you know that you have a killer and you may be down for a long time. Luckily, melatonin supplement takes care of this fast and before you know it, you will be back on your feet. Note that you should only take small doses for jetlag treatment. By inducing sleepiness, you will find it very helpful because hours of sleep at the right time will put right your body clock. Melatonin for non-24-hour-sleep-wake syndrome
Melatonin sleep supplementation has proved very effective for the non-24-hour-sleep-wake syndrome, which is a disorder of the circadian rhythm. Here, the pattern of delay in sleeping or waking up happens all round the day and it can be very disconcerting. Non-24 is classified under diseases of the central nervous system.
